My ficus ginseng bonsai - if you want to call it an actual bonsai ;) - has grown quite a bit over winter. As this growth tends to be rather large, it was time to prune it back before growth season fully starts.

When is the best time/season to prune ginseng ficus bonsai? And when is the best time to shape branches? Thank you :)
@ThatBonsaiGuy
@ThatBonsaiGuy Год назад
If you keep it indoor you can basically prune whenever there is a need for it, but more conservatively early in the growth season and towards the end of the growth season are good times to prune. I usually wire branches by the end of cold season so over the next growth season thr branches can already settle into their new shape. :)
